Data Storage & Privacy

  • Store personal, educational, and family data under explicit role-based access controls.
  • Encrypt sensitive data in transit using TLS and at rest using provider-managed encryption plus app-level controls for high-sensitivity fields.
  • Provide consent flows for parent and teacher access, with revocation and audit trails.
  • Support GDPR and CCPA requests for export, deletion, and data minimization.
  • Avoid storing raw prompts longer than necessary and separate generated content from source documents where feasible.

Scalability & Performance

  • Use pagination, lazy loading, and index-driven queries for large libraries and analytics views.
  • Batch AI generation jobs and queue expensive operations to avoid blocking the UI.
  • Cache frequently used study metadata and recent content locally for offline-first speed.
  • Design Firestore documents to avoid hot spots and oversized nested collections.

Potential Challenges

  • AI hallucinations could reduce trust; mitigate with citations, confidence labels, and safe fallback responses.
  • Firestore query cost could rise with large content libraries; mitigate with careful indexing, denormalized read models, and pagination.
  • Offline sync conflicts could corrupt user intent; mitigate with field-level conflict resolution and last-edited metadata.
  • Role-based privacy mistakes could expose student data; mitigate with explicit permission models, security rules, and automated tests.
  • Content processing delays for OCR and PDF parsing could frustrate users; mitigate with background jobs, progress states, and partial availability of extracted content.
